General
Sim Type | Dual Sim, GSM+GSM | Single Sim, GSM |
Dual Sim | Yes | No |
Sim Size | Nano SIM | |
Device Type | Smartphone | |
Release Date | June, 2015 | February, 2008 |
Design
Dimensions | 72 x 151 x 9.8 mm | 45 x 111 x 13 mm |
Weight | 155 g | 85 g |
Design Type | Classic (Candybar) |
Display
Type | Color (16M colors Colors) | Color TFT Screen (16M colors Colors) |
Touch | Yes | No |
Size | 5.2 inches, 1440 x 2560 pixels | 2 inches, 240 x 320 pixels |
Aspect Ratio | 16:9 | 4:3 |
PPI | ~ 565 PPI | ~ 200 PPI |
Memory
Phonebook | 2000 entries | |
RAM | 3 GB | |
Storage | 32 GB | 24 MB |
Card Slot | Yes, upto 128 GB | Yes, upto 8 GB |
Connectivity
GPRS | Yes | Yes |
EDGE | Yes | Yes |
3G | Yes | Yes |
4G | Yes | |
Wifi | Yes, with wifi-hotspot | No |
Bluetooth | Yes, v4.1 | Yes, v2.0 |
USB | Yes, microUSB v2.0 | Yes, microUSB v2.0 |
Extra
GPS | Yes, with A-GPS Support | |
Fingerprint Sensor | Yes | |
Sensors | Accelerometer, Gyroscope, Compass | |
3.5mm Headphone Jack | Yes | No |
NFC | Yes | |
Extra | DLNA |
Camera
Rear Camera | 20 MP with autofocus | 2 MP |
Features | Face detection, Smile detection, Geo tagging, Panorama | |
Video Recording | 4K @ 30 fps UHD | 480p @ 15 fps |
Flash | Yes, Dual LED | Yes, LED |
Front Camera | 4 MP | 0.07 MP |
Technical
OS | Android v5.0.2 (Lollipop) | |
Chipset | Mediatek Helio X10 | |
CPU | 2.2 GHz, Octa Core Processor | |
Java | No | Yes, MIDP v2 |
Browser | Yes, supports HTML | Yes, supports HTML/Flash |
Multimedia
Supports | MMS | MMS, Instant Messaging, Voice Recording, Voice Commands, Calendar |
Yes, with Push Email | Yes, with Push Email | |
Music | MP3, eAAC+, WMA, WAV, FLAC | MP3, AAC, eAAC+, WMA, MP4 |
Video | DivX, XviD, MP4, H.264, WMV | MPEG4, H.263, H.264 |
FM Radio | Yes | Yes |
Document Reader | Yes |
Battery
Type | Non-Removable Battery | Removable Battery |
Size | 2840 mAh, Li-Po Battery | 1000 mAh, Li-ion Battery |
StandBy Time | 24 days | 12 days |
Talk Time | 23 hours | 210 min |
